Search for the Decay \(B^0 \rightarrow \omega \gamma \) at Belle II

We present the preliminary results from the analysis of this rare radiative decay \(B^0 \rightarrow \omega \gamma \) using simulated data from the Belle II detector at the SuperKEKB asymmetric-energy \( e^+ e^-\) collider, operating at the \(\varUpsilon (4S)\) resonance. The predicted value of the decay branching fraction lies in the range of \(10^{-6}-10^{-7}\) within the standard model. This analysis aims to search for this rare radiative decay for the first time using Belle II data.
